The lightbox is a tool that can be used to help students have access to literacy materials.  In the past, it has been used for students with multiple disabilities, including those with cortical or cerebral visual impairments (CVI), however, it can be used for a wide range of students to help engage them in the learning process.  The lightbox can be used to build upon visual skills while the lit background helps to draw the student's attention to what is being presented.  The lightbox allows for fun and engaging learning.   

Learning Objectives 
Participants will 
 - be instructed on how to effectively use the lightbox.
- be given different eye hand coordination activities to use with the lightbox.
- be introduced to fine motor skills activities to use with the lightbox.- 
- learn how to use the lightbox to introduce familiar objects/pictures.
- engage in low cost activities to use with the lightbox.
